From my searches last night , it seems to be a legitimate pop up.

I don't know why it is showing up for you now though..
Maybe something got scrambled or deleted recently...and now the system is letting you know this file is missing...

It might have happened when the computer was worked on recently.

Another option is to try a system restore, back to before the pop up showed up...


you can find more details on the Microsoft site or HP site - in the support sections or just do a search on those sites.

you can find info on stopping the pop up also if you don't want to install the controller. or if it keeps popping up.

You do have Microsoft/Windows updates enabled - correct??
They usually are released on Tuesdays/Wednesdays and should be set to automatically install for you.
